Abstract

Paprika is a commodity that being developed in Pasuruan Regency. Paprika supply chain activities in Pasuruan Regency have problems in supply availability and development of marketing strategies. Fixing the problem allows paprika from Pasuruan Regency to compete with another commodity producers and expanse their market products. The purpose of this study is to determine the model of the institutional structure of the supply chain of paprika, to determine the elements, sub-elements, and relationships between each element in the supply chain. This study used Interpretive Structural Modeling (ISM) for method which involves 5 experts as respondents. The results show that there are four key elements including elements of constraints, needs, goals and institutions involved. Based on the Dependence Drive-Power (DP-D) matrix, the key sub-elements of the needs element are capital, were positioned in the independent sector. The DP-D matrix for key sub-elements of the element of need is the improvement of distribution facilities and infrastructure and the enhancement of the role of farmer groups were positioned in the linkage sector. In the DP-D Matrix for objective elements, there are key sub-elements, namely increasing productivity in the Linkage sector. Actors who act as key sub-elements of the elements of the institution involved are farmers and wholesalers. The findings of this study suggest several managerial implications to be carried out in paprika supply chain activities namely increasing productivity, coordinating between actors in the supply chain, obtaining capital assistance, and assistance in facilities both in production and distribution activities by the government. © 2019 Institute of Physics Publishing.
